Unlocking Global Reach: The Future of Music Distribution

The music industry is constantly evolving at an unprecedented pace. Artists no longer need to rely on traditional record labels to reach a global audience. With the rise of digital platforms and innovative distribution systems, musicians have gained unprecedented control over their careers. Streaming services have revolutionized how we consume music, making it instantly accessible to listeners worldwide. This has generated a new era of opportunity for independent artists to display their talents to a wider base.

Furthermore, social media platforms have become invaluable tools for marketing music and building a loyal fan base. Artists can now immediately connect with their listeners, share updates, and cultivate relationships that surpass geographical boundaries.

The future of music distribution is undeniably global. As technology continues to progress, we can expect even more seamless ways for artists to share their music with the world.

Music Distribution 2025: Trends Shaping the Industry Landscape

The music market of 2025 promises to be a dynamic and shifting landscape. With technological advancements shaping consumer habits, artists will need to evolve their distribution strategies to prosper.

One key trend is the increase of independent artists who are leveraging platforms like Bandcamp to reach fans directly. This facilitates artists to own their music and build genuine connections with their audiences.

Furthermore, the combination of music distribution with other platforms like virtual experiences and artificial systems is creating new avenues for artists to experiment.

The future of music distribution is positive, with a focus on empowerment and the exploration of innovative models that connect artists and fans in new and meaningful ways.

Unveiling the Digital Realm: A Deep Dive into Music Distribution

In today's rapidly evolving music landscape, digital delivery has reshaped the way music is listened to. Gone are the days of physical albums and vinyl records. Musicians now have a myriad of options to disseminate their music globally through online platforms. From streaming giants like Spotify and Apple Music to independent aggregators, the digital music market offers a plethora of avenues for artists to connect their audience.

  • Moreover, digital distribution allows musicians to retain a greater share of their earnings compared to traditional models. This shift has empowered independent artists and created new opportunities for musical innovation

Despite this, navigating the complexities of digital music distribution can be daunting for some musicians. Understanding the various platforms, rights and marketing strategies is essential for success in this dynamic environment.
